Description edit see section history

In London on a personal matter, Dracula encounters Sherlock Holmes, who is attempting to catch a killer and stop a ring of criminal masterminds who are threatening to loose plague-infested rats into the streets. Reissue.

Crime Makes Strange Partnerships
And none stranger than that between Sherlock Holmes and Count Dracula.
Holmes confronts a pair of impossible problems: a ring of criminal masterminds threatening to loose thousands of plague-infested rats into the streets of London and a bizarre killer who leaves a trail of bloodless corpses... and no other clues....
Dracula holds the key to both mysteries. Returned to London on a personal matter, the Count is quickly entangled in a web of evil that even his undead powers may not be enough to breach.
Here are the secrets of The Holmes-Dracula File

Series & Lists edit see section history

This is book 2 of 10 in The Dracula Series. (standard series)

Preceded by The Dracula Tape, and followed by An Old Friend of the Family.

First Edition edit see section history

Original Language: English
Publisher: Ace Books
Country: United States
Publication Date: November 1978
ISBN: 0441342450
Page Count: 249
